摘要
The introduction of advanced Multistage Depressed Collectors (MDC) to high-power fusion gyrotrons will be the key to increase the gyrotron overall efficiency above 60 % as required for future DEMOnstration power plant. MDCs which base on the ExB drift concept might solve the fundamental issue of handling the secondary electrons. To consider the effect of secondary electrons in a stationary state, full 3D Particle-In-Cell (PIC) simulations are performed. A novel two-stage collector designed using PIC is presented which shows an excellent collector efficiency of up to 77 %. Moreover, the undesired generation of secondary electrons only reduces the efficiency by 1 %, compared to a typical 10 % efficiency reduction in other known classical concepts.
